The Shiller PE Ratio was first used by professor Robert Shiller. He uses E10 for his Shiller PE Ratio calculation. E10 is the average of the inflation adjusted earnings per share of a company over the past 10 years. The similar calculation is applied by GuruFocus to calculate the Cyclically Adjusted PS Ratio. The Cyclically Adjusted Revenue per Share is the average of the inflation adjusted revenue per share of a company over the past 10 years.

Kamdhenu's adjusted revenue per share data for the three months ended in Jun. 2026 was ₹7.586. Add all the adjusted revenue per share for the past 10 years together and divide 10 will get our Cyclically Adjusted Revenue per Share, which is ₹45.23 for the trailing ten years ended in Jun. 2026.

Kamdhenu  (BOM:532741) Cyclically Adjusted PS Ratio Explanation

Compared with the regular PS Ratio, which works poorly for cyclical businesses, the Cyclically Adjusted PS Ratio smoothed out the fluctuations of revenue during business cycles. Therefore it is more accurate in reflecting the valuation of the company.

If a company has consistent business performance, the Cyclically Adjusted PS Ratio should give similar results to regular PS Ratio.

Kamdhenu Cyclically Adjusted PS Ratio Calculation

Like the Shiller PE Ratio, the Cyclically Adjusted PS Ratio takes the Revenue per Share from the past 10 years, adjusts it for inflation, and then calculates the average. This average is then used for the P/S calculation. Because it considers this 10-year average, it's often referred to as the CAPS Ratio.

The Shiller PE Ratio was first used by professor Robert Shiller to measure the valuation of the overall market. The similar calculation is applied by GuruFocus to calculate the Cyclically Adjusted PS Ratio.

Kamdhenu's Cyclically Adjusted PS Ratio for today is calculated as

Cyclically Adjusted PS Ratio=Share Price/ Cyclically Adjusted Revenue per Share
=35.27/45.23
=0.78

Kamdhenu Business Description

Other Exchanges KAMDHENU:India
Address Tower-A, 2nd Floor, Building Number 9, DLF Cyber City, Phase - III, Gurugram, HR, IND, 122 002
Kamdhenu Ltd is an Indian company engaged in the manufacturing, marketing, branding, and distribution of thermo-mechanically treated (TMT) steel bars, structural steel, and allied products under the brand name Kamdhenu. The company operates through a franchise-based model with over 80 franchise units involved in manufacturing TMT bars, structural steel products, color-coated profile sheets, and other allied materials. Kamdhenu also manufactures paints under the brand Colour Dreamz, including eco-friendly options. Its manufacturing facilities are located in Rajasthan, India, and it serves a broad customer base through an extensive dealer network across the country. The company's revenue is majorly generated from steel segment.
